No. 77 SENATE RESOLUTION WHEREAS, The Senate of the State of Texas is pleased to recognize the Valley Initiative for Development and Advancement on the occasion of its 25th anniversary; and WHEREAS, This innovative service organization was established in response to dramatic job losses in the Rio Grande Valley's textile industry that began in the mid-1990s; by 2003, more than 8,000 workers had lost jobs in a region already faced with severe underemployment; and WHEREAS, Structured through the combined efforts of Valley Interfaith and private industry leaders, VIDA was founded on a mission to create new institutional relationships that address the demands of local employers and that provide workers with the skills, training, and resources they need to attain new high-paying jobs; and WHEREAS, Through supplemental support from private businesses and local, state, and federal governments, VIDA is able to break down economic barriers for training and career advancement; craft and trade initiatives provide on-the-job training opportunities that allow students to work with contractors only a few months after beginning their trade programs; and WHEREAS, In the years since its establishment, VIDA has enabled numerous individuals to create new paths for self-sufficiency and to build strong foundations for their families; all who are associated with the organization can reflect with pride on the institution's proud tradition of service in the community; now, therefore, be it RESOLVED, That the Senate of the State of Texas, 87th Legislature, 3rd Called Session, hereby commend the administrators, staff, and partners who serve with the Valley Initiative for Development and Advancement and congratulate them on the initiative's 25th anniversary; and, be it further RESOLVED, That a copy of this Resolution be prepared for this organization as an expression of esteem from the Texas Senate.
